Subject: Re: [PATCH] scsi: docs: clean up some style in scsi_mid_low_api
Date: Mon, 05 May 2025 22:32:53 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<yq1ecx2v581.fsf@ca-mkp.ca.oracle.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250502015136.683691-1-rdunlap@infradead.org> (Randy Dunlap's message of "Thu, 1 May 2025 18:51:36 -0700")
Randy,
> Capitalize Linux but not "kernel."
> Spell out Linux instead of using "lk".
> Hyphenate "system-wide."
> Hyphenate "32-bit".
> End a sentence with a period (full stop).
> Change "double linked" to "doubly linked" list.
> Use SCSI or scsi but not Scsi.
Applied to 6.16/scsi-staging, thanks!
